Before depositing at any online casino, take five minutes to read this checklist — it covers the steps most players skip.
Quick Checklist
- Verify the casino holds a valid license from a reputable authority (Curacao eGaming is common).
- Read the bonus terms: wagering requirements, game contributions, and maximum bet limits.
- Check the list of restricted countries and ensure yours is allowed.
- Understand the withdrawal policy: minimum/maximum amounts, processing times, and pending periods.
- Set a budget and stick to it; never chase losses.

Calculating Your Bonus
Understanding the bonus math helps you decide whether an offer is worthwhile. Suppose the casino offers a 100% match bonus up to $1,000 on your first deposit, with a 30x wagering requirement on the deposit plus bonus amount.
If you deposit $500, you receive a $500 bonus, giving you $1,000 total balance. The wagering requirement is 30 × ($500 + $500) = 30 × $1,000 = $30,000.
You must play through $30,000 before any winnings from the bonus become withdrawable. If the game contributes 100% (slots), every $1 bet counts $1. If blackjack contributes only 10%, then a $10 bet counts $1 towards the requirement.
To calculate the expected loss during wagering, multiply the wagering amount by the house edge. For slots with a 96% RTP (4% house edge): 0.04 × $30,000 = $1,200 expected loss. Since your initial deposit is $500 and bonus $500, the expected value (EV) is your starting balance minus expected loss: $1,000 – $1,200 = –$200 EV. This shows you are likely to lose money even with the bonus. The house edge makes positive EV rare. Use this formula to evaluate any offer.
Tip: Always check the maximum bet allowed while wagering — typically $5 or $10 — and avoid high-variance games that can drain your balance quickly.

When Things Go Wrong
Even well-run casinos can have hiccups. Here are common problems and how to solve them:
- Deposit not credited: First, check your payment provider for the transaction status. If confirmed, refresh your account or log out and back in. If still missing, contact customer support with the transaction ID.
- Withdrawal pending for days: Verify that you have completed all KYC requirements. If so, check the casino’s pending time (usually 24–72 hours). If exceeded, open a support ticket.
- Account verification fails: Ensure your documents are clear, in color, and exactly match your registered name. If rejected, ask support which documents are acceptable.
- Bonus not activated: Confirm you opted in during deposit. Check the bonus code field. If still missing, contact support before playing any games.
- Game not loading: Clear your browser cache and cookies. Try a different browser or device. Disable ad-blockers temporarily. If the issue persists, check if the game is under maintenance.
- Connection drops during gameplay: Your bet may still be active. Log back in and check your bet history. Click “Pending bets” to see if the round ended.
